    We like First Watch for their high-quality ingredients and consistency of food preparation. Another unique First Watch deliverable is the seasoning on their foods. You almost never have to add salt, pepper or hot sauce. My hubby and I had breakfast at First Watch. He had the French Toast with Blueberry Sauce and I had Avocado Toast with egg whites. The Avocado Toast was delicious with only three ingredients avocado, toast and extra virgin olive oil (on the menu EVOO...I had to ask what that meant...probably the only person on the planet that did not know. My hubby looked at me when I asked the question as if I am so embarrassed that you did not know that. However, if you do not ask, you will not know. It did not phase me one bit.) So, now I know...if you did not know, now you know. Smile. The foundation of the avocado toast was a piece of hearty thick-cut whole grain toast topped with a layer of fresh smashed avocado, lightly tossed with EVOO. I opted for two cage-free egg whites on the side. You can always tell fresh eggs because they are not watery. These eggs were as fluffy as a cloud. This dish was very filling and delicious...so much food I could only eat half of my toast. The remainder of my toast was packed up to go. My hubby opted for the decadent First Watch's French toast. These two thick slices of brioche bread were lightly toasted to a golden brown. Inside the French toast had a soft, custardy consistency yet not soggy. The outside of the French toast was crispy and flavorful when drizzled with the blueberry sauce and syrup. The French toast paired nicely with the blueberry sauce and syrup...tangy and sweet simultaneously. My hubby ate both pieces of his toast. Brittany, our server, was fantastic! She frequently checked on us to ensure that we were having a great dining experience. Brittany was a top notch server! While we do not dine frequently at First Watch, we always feel at home and very welcomed. One server opened the door for us when we entered the restaurant to say good morning and welcome. Brittany opened the door for us as we left to say thank you, have a nice day and look forward to seeing you soon. It is these nice little touches that make us want to visit again.
